If the area in which you live is susceptible to floods or mudslides, it is important to inquire about buying supplemental flood insurance. Most standard home owner’s policies do not provide coverage for floods, but you may buy additional coverage via the federal government that will protect you from this damage.

You could reduce your total premium you pay by having a higher deductible. Higher deductibles work to decrease your cost because it increases the threshold of insurance. You will pay more from your pocket in case of damage, but the cost can be offset by the amount you pay for your premiums.

A standard homeowner’s insurance policy will probably not be sufficient enough for you if you like in an earthquake zone. The standard homeowner’s policy covers damage to your house from vandalism, lightning, fire or vandalism. Basic policies also normally cover your personal property losses due to theft. You may need a separate rider or policy to keep your home protected from earthquakes.
